Why Manufacturing Sales Expertise Really Matters

Manufacturing sales isn’t your typical B2B selling game. Your prospects are engineers, production managers, and operations directors who can spot a generic pitch from miles away. They need sales professionals who understand lean manufacturing principles, can discuss Industry 4.0 technologies intelligently, and know the difference between MRP and ERP systems without googling it. FAQs for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representative

  • These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representatives are experienced with major ERP platforms like SAP, Oracle NetSuite, Microsoft Dynamics 365, Epicor, and Infor CloudSuite. They understand how these systems integrate with production planning, inventory management, and supply chain operations, enabling them to effectively demonstrate value propositions to manufacturing prospects.

  • Filipino sales professionals can effectively sell industrial automation solutions including PLCs, SCADA systems, robotics, and IoT sensors. Many have engineering backgrounds or technical certifications that help them understand manufacturing processes, conduct needs assessments, and articulate ROI for automation investments to decision-makers.

  • Philippine-based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representatives are well-versed in US manufacturing standards including ISO 9001, FDA regulations for medical device manufacturing, and industry-specific requirements like AS9100 for aerospace. They can confidently discuss compliance benefits when positioning quality management systems or process improvement solutions.

  • Remote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representatives coordinate virtual demonstrations using platforms like Microsoft Teams or Zoom, working closely with technical teams to showcase equipment functionality through live video feeds or pre-recorded facility tours. On-site demonstrations with local partners are also scheduled when hands-on evaluation is critical for closing deals.

  • Proficiency with manufacturing-focused CRM systems like Salesforce Manufacturing Cloud, HubSpot with custom industrial pipelines, and specialized platforms like IQMS or Plex Systems is common among outsourced sales representatives. They track complex B2B sales cycles, manage multi-stakeholder accounts, and maintain detailed records of technical specifications discussed.

  • Detailed quotes for custom equipment, tooling, and integrated systems can be prepared by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representatives. They use CPQ (Configure, Price, Quote) software, collaborate with engineering teams to ensure technical accuracy, and factor in variables like production volumes, material specifications, and implementation timelines.

  • Knowledge of lean manufacturing principles, Six Sigma, Kaizen, and continuous improvement methodologies is held by Philippine-based sales professionals. This expertise helps them identify pain points in production processes and position solutions that reduce waste, improve efficiency, and enhance overall equipment effectiveness (OEE).

  • Active support of trade show participation is provided by Filipino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representatives through qualifying leads collected at events, conducting pre-show outreach to schedule booth meetings, and following up with prospects post-event. They also monitor virtual trade shows and webinars to identify opportunities and stay current with industry trends.

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representative: A Typical Day

For a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representative, handling daily tasks effectively is crucial to driving sales and ensuring customer satisfaction. This role combines technical knowledge with interpersonal skills to address the specific needs of manufacturers, making it essential to manage tasks efficiently. By focusing on a structured daily routine, the representative can streamline their efforts to maximize productivity and responsiveness to client inquiries.

Morning Routine (Your Business Hours Start)

The day begins with the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representative reviewing their calendar and prioritizing tasks for the day. First thing in the morning, they check emails for any urgent messages or updates from clients and internal teams. They prepare by gathering necessary materials, which may include product specifications, client meeting notes, and updated sales reports. Initial communications focus on confirming meetings and addressing any immediate client needs, allowing them to set a clear agenda for the day ahead.

Client Relationship Management

A core responsibility for the Sales Representative involves managing relationships with existing and potential clients. Utilizing a Customer Relationship Management (CRM) system like Salesforce or HubSpot, they track interactions, monitor sales progress, and update contact details. Regular check-ins with clients help maintain rapport, ensure satisfaction with current solutions, and identify opportunities for upselling or cross-selling additional products. The representative may dedicate specific time slots throughout the day to reach out to clients via phone calls or personalized emails, ensuring timely communication and support.

Product Knowledge Updates

A crucial area of focus for the Sales Representative is staying updated on the latest manufacturing solutions and technology trends. To enhance their product knowledge, they dedicate time to reviewing product guides, attending webinars, or conducting research on industry innovations. This knowledge enables them to provide informed recommendations and address customer questions effectively. They may collaborate with engineering teams to gain insights into product developments, ensuring they are well-prepared to discuss new offerings with clients as needed.

Sales Pipeline Management

Another significant responsibility is managing the sales pipeline. The Representative closely monitors prospective deals, following up on quotations and proposals submitted to clients. They use project management tools like Asana or Trello to track the status of sales tasks, ensuring that every part of the sales process is moving forward. Regular updates and strategy sessions with the sales team help align efforts and share insights, optimizing the likelihood of closing deals efficiently.

End of Day Wrap Up

As the day comes to a close, the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representative takes time to review accomplishments and outstanding tasks. They update the CRM system with notes from the day’s meetings and communications, ensuring that all relevant information is documented for future reference. Preparing for the next day involves prioritizing follow-up tasks and setting clear goals. Status updates are communicated with team members, ensuring a seamless transition of responsibilities if necessary. This end-of-day routine reinforces organization and accountability.

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representative vs Similar Roles

Hire a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representative when:

  • Your business is focused on industrial solutions and requires a specialized sales approach to complex manufacturing products
  • You need a representative who can provide technical knowledge to understand both customer needs and product capabilities
  • Your market requires building strong relationships with key accounts in the manufacturing sector for long-term collaboration
  • You aim to improve sales in a highly competitive landscape that demands targeted strategies for unique manufacturing client needs
  • Your organization is launching new products requiring dedicated sales efforts and technical expertise to communicate their value effectively

Consider an Account Executive instead if:

  • Your focus is on broader sales strategies across multiple industries rather than specialized manufacturing solutions
  • You require a role that handles a wider range of product types and services beyond specific manufacturing applications
  • Your organization depends more on volume sales rather than deep technical sales with a limited range of products

Consider a Client Relationship Manager instead if:

  • Your emphasis is on maintaining and nurturing existing client relationships rather than actively seeking new manufacturing sales
  • You need a role focused on customer satisfaction and retention rather than direct product sales efforts
  • Your business model leans heavily on repeat business from existing accounts rather than new client acquisition in manufacturing

Consider an Technical Sales Specialist instead if:

  • Your products require a deeper level of technical expertise and consultation during the sales process beyond what a Manufacturing Solutions Sales Representative typically offers
  • You are targeting high-tech industries or advanced machinery sectors that demand extensive product knowledge and application skills
  • Your sales process involves detailed product demonstrations or custom solutions, necessitating a more technically-inclined salesperson

Businesses often start with one role and expand their sales teams as needs grow, ensuring they have the right experts in place for diverse markets and challenges.
